#acf5af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#acf5af is composed of 67.5% red, 96.1%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.6%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 122.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.5% and a lightness of 81.8%. #acf5af color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#59eb5f.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

Shades and Tints of #acf5af

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010501 is the darkest color, while #f2fdf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#acf5af

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d0d1d0 is the less saturated color, while #a5fca8 is the most saturated one.
